What is Flexi Trade AI?
FlexiTrade AI is an online trading platform that claims to utilize AI-driven strategies to generate substantial returns for its investors. The platform promises a daily passive ROI of 3% and offers referral commissions to its affiliates for recruitment. While the concept of AI-driven trading is intriguing, there are some alarming red flags surrounding this company.
FlexiTrade AI’s website lacks transparency when it comes to ownership and executive information. The absence of verifiable details regarding the individuals behind the platform is a glaring issue. While they do list some executives, there is no evidence to suggest that these individuals exist outside of the FlexiTrade AI website. This raises suspicions that these may be hired actors or even stolen profile photos, leaving potential investors in the dark about who is truly running the show.
Business Model
FlexiTrade AI’s business plan revolves on clients investing in $25 Flexi Trade Unit positions (FTUs) with the promise of a 3% daily ROI. The lack of specific details in the compensation plan raises further concerns. The platform does mention the possibility of earning referral commissions of up to 65% based on team volume in five levels, indicating a recruitment-driven system. This multi-level commission structure is a hallmark of MLM schemes.
One of the most concerning aspects of FlexiTrade AI is its lack of retailable products or services. customers are primarily focused on marketing FlexiTrade AI affiliate memberships, which is a red flag characteristic of many MLM (Multi-Level Marketing) schemes. The absence of tangible products or services calls into question the legitimacy of the platform’s claims.
Joining FlexiTrade AI is free, but full participation in the income opportunity requires a minimum $25 investment, solicited in tether (USDT). The platform claims that it uses automated AI trading to generate external revenue. However, there is no verifiable evidence that FlexiTrade AI pays withdrawals using trading revenue. This lack of transparency and verifiable proof raises skepticism about the legitimacy of their trading activities.
Flexi Trade AI Ponzi Scheme
The Ponzi Scheme concern is particularly alarming. If the FlexiTrade AI algorithm genuinely is capable of consistently generating a 3% daily ROI, one might question why they would need external investments. The primary source of revenue for FlexiTrade AI appears to be new investments, a classic characteristic of a Ponzi scheme. As with all Ponzi schemes, when new recruitment slows down, the platform will struggle to sustain payouts, potentially leading to its collapse.
